Understanding Game Optimization Techniques
Optimizing your gaming experience involves several key considerations, extending beyond simply choosing the right platform. First and foremost, understanding your system's capabilities is crucial. This means assessing your processor, graphics card, RAM, and storage device to identify potential bottlenecks. Older hardware might require reducing graphical settings within games to maintain a smooth frame rate. Conversely, newer, more powerful systems can handle higher settings, resulting in a more visually immersive experience. Regularly updating your graphics drivers is also paramount, as these updates often include performance enhancements and bug fixes specifically tailored for recent game releases. Furthermore, closing unnecessary background applications can free up system resources dedicated to gameplay, minimizing lag and stuttering. Effective game optimization isn't a one-time task, but rather a continuous process of monitoring and adjusting settings based on your specific hardware and the demands of the games you play.
The Role of Network Connectivity
A stable and fast internet connection is non-negotiable for online gaming. Lag, or latency, can ruin even the most exciting multiplayer matches. Prioritizing your gaming connection through Quality of Service (QoS) settings on your router can ensure that game traffic receives precedence over other network activity, such as streaming or downloading. Consider using a wired Ethernet connection instead of Wi-Fi whenever possible, as it provides a more reliable and consistent connection with lower latency. Regularly testing your internet speed and ping can help you identify potential issues and troubleshoot connection problems. Understanding the impact of network conditions on your gameplay is critical for a lag-free and enjoyable online experience. Even with a high-speed connection, factors like distance to the game server and server load can influence performance.
| Setting | Impact on Performance |
|---|---|
| Resolution | Higher resolution demands more processing power. |
| Texture Quality | Higher texture quality uses more VRAM. |
| Shadow Effects | Complex shadows significantly impact frame rate. |
| Anti-Aliasing | Reduces jagged edges, but can be resource-intensive. |
Analyzing these setting adjustments allows players to carefully balance visual fidelity with desired framerates, leading to a more tailored and optimized gaming setup. Finding the sweet spot between these creates a seamless and engaging experience.

Analyzing Your Own Gameplay
One of the most effective ways to improve your gaming skills is to analyze your own gameplay. Recording your matches and reviewing them later can reveal areas where you made mistakes or could have played more effectively. Pay attention to your decision-making process, your positioning, your timing, and your resource management. Identifying patterns in your errors can help you develop strategies to avoid repeating them in the future. Don't be afraid to seek feedback from other players, as they may notice things that you missed. Analyzing your gameplay is a continuous process of self-improvement, and it's a crucial step towards reaching your full potential as a gamer. It’s about recognizing and refining your approach to become more adaptable and resourceful.
